Hello All, I used Bills latest wsjtx-1.5.0-rc2.tgz posted in the files section to update the my PPA on Launchpad ( WSJTX-DEV ). I'm using that name so when v1.5.0 is fully released, I can push an update to the Debian developers for the current version of WSJT-X (v1.1) in the Debian/Ubuntu repositories without running into any conflicts. This also allows us to test release candidates without having to go through a formal release / update process with the Debian FTP Masters.
The build method is utilizing Bill's SuperBuild Script which includes his Hamlib3 version. Supported ARCH: i386, amd64 Supported Distros: Ubuntu 14.04, 14.10, 15.04, 15.10 Supported Distro Names: Trusty, Utpoic, Vivid, Wily Note: 15.10 (Ubuntu Wily) is the next Ubuntu release, and is under heavy development, be prepared for issues there. BUILD and INSTALLATION COMMENTS: Overall, things went as expected on build and install. There are a couple of niggles that need to be addressed, but nothing major: * Lintian Error: binary-without-manpage usr/bin/message_aggregator. We just need to add the manpage for message_aggregator is all. * I had to delete the WSJTX.ini file in ~/.config in order for the frequency list to appear. With all the traffic being posted on this, Im not sure what the status of this is at the moment. * There's duplications on a couple files, GPL & Changelog stuff, but that will be resolved at the package maintainer level. INSTALL / UPGRADE INFO If you need instructions for Installing the PPA, I can post them. Updating the PPA would be through a normal Update && Upgrade. I can, after you post the formal message for the release of 1.5.0 RC2, post availability and installation instructions for the PPA. The PPA also depends on kvasd-installer, so the user should get the package installed automatically. However, I've not added the pre/post install script to trigger installing the KVASD binary, that will be part of the next RC update package or the formal release, whichever comes first.
